Regis College and Linfield University-School of Nursing, both esteemed institutions of higher learning, offer distinct educational experiences. Regis College, nestled in Weston, Massachusetts, boasts a higher acceptance rate, allowing more students to pursue their academic aspirations. Linfield University-School of Nursing, located in McMinnville, Oregon, stands out with its smaller student body, fostering a close-knit community. While Regis College excels in the fields of Business, Management, Marketing, and Related Support Services, Linfield University-School of Nursing specializes in Registered Nursing, Nursing Administration, Nursing Research and Clinical Nursing.
